What Is Butter Paper and What Makes It Ideal for Food Packaging?

Custom butter paper is actually a lightweight food wrapping paper. It features a smooth and clean surface. It is designed to handle the light grease and moisture of various foods. This assists in keeping the exterior clean in case of serving, storage, and takeout. The paper is also flexible. So it can wrap foods of different shapes without becoming bulky.

A major advantage of butter paper lies in the fact that it minimises oil and grease transfer. It is compatible with foods that have butter, cream, or light oils. It also gives food a clean as well as beautiful appearance. This is owing to its smooth texture. This works great for bakeries, cafes, restaurants, and food booths.

Butter paper wraps butter, cheese, pastries, cookies, and even sandwiches.  Also, it is ideal for enveloping delicate food. It can be used to separate baked goods in boxes and trays. Where Is Custom Butter Paper Used? 

Custom butter paper is applicable in most food businesses. It offers a clean surface to wrap, line, and present food. Plus, it is light and grease-resistant. It can be used with foods containing butter, cream, chocolate, and light oils. It also assists brands in producing a presentable and professional presentation of food.

Bakeries and Pastry Shops

Butter paper is used in bakeries for croissants and cookies, muffins, cakes, and pastries. It can wrap bakery boxes or wrap single baked items. The smooth surface is gentle on delicate foods. It is also useful in maintaining boxes free of light grease and crumbs.

Chocolatiers and Sweet Shops

Butter paper packs chocolates, fudge, candies, and homemade sweets. The sheets can separate individual pieces inside gift boxes. This aids in keeping every item tidy. Custom printing can also add logos or patterns for a more attractive presentation.

Gourmet Food Brands

Gourmet brands typically pay much attention to minor details of presentation. Butter paper is suitable for cheese, baked delicacies, homemade snacks, and specialty food. What to Look For When Choosing Custom Butter Paper?

The choice of the right custom butter paper will conserve the food and improve presentation. When making an order, consider the food category you require, frequency of need, branding you need, and packaging you intend to use on your order.

Check Grease Resistance

The resistance to grease must be appropriate to the food you present. Pastries, cheese, sandwiches, and buttery foods can leave oil marks. Butter paper is good in that it makes grease light under control and boxes, trays, and hands are kept clean.

Choose the Right Thickness

The thickness influences strength and handling. Thin paper actually works for light pastries, cookies, and chocolates. Heavier sheets have more support over larger food items. Choose paper that folds easily without tearing during normal use. 

Confirm Food Safety

Always use paper that may be used in food contact. Enquire of your supplier regarding food-safe materials, finishes, and printing inks. Proper paper makes you more confident in packing food.

Look at Printing Quality

Clear printing makes your packaging look more professional. Your brand information, patterns, and logo should be sharp. High-quality printing can make ordinary wrapping something of use and branded.

Select the Correct Size

Choose sheet sizes based on your food portions and packaging. As appropriate sizes, wrapping is also quicker and consumes less paper.

Butter Paper vs. Other Wrapping Options

The food papers have their purposes. The correct decision depends on grease, heat, type of food, and presentation requirements.

Butter Paper vs. Wax Paper

Butter paper suits delicate foods with light grease. Custom wax paper provides better protection against more oily or wet foods.

Butter Paper vs. Parchment Paper

Parchment paper suits well for heat and baking. Butter paper is good to wrap pastries, chocolates, and candy and other delicate foods.
